ULONG gLockCount;
ULONG gClassCount;
HINSTANCE gInstance;
#define CLSID_FOR_CLASS(cls) CLSID_##cls,
static CLSID gRegCLSIDs[] = {
FOR_EACH_COCLASS(CLSID_FOR_CLASS)
};
#undef CLSID_FOR_CLASS
void shutDownWebKit()
{
WebCore::iconDatabase()->close();
}
STDAPI_(BOOL) DllMain( HMODULE hModule, DWORD ul_reason_for_call, LPVOID /*lpReserved*/)
{
switch (ul_reason_for_call) {
case DLL_PROCESS_ATTACH:
gLockCount = gClassCount = 0;
gInstance = hModule;
WebCore::Page::setInstanceHandle(hModule);
return TRUE;
case DLL_PROCESS_DETACH:
shutDownWebKit();
break;
case DLL_THREAD_ATTACH:
case DLL_THREAD_DETACH:
break;
}
return FALSE;
}
STDAPI DllGetClassObject(REFCLSID rclsid, REFIID riid, LPVOID* ppv)
{
bool found = false;
for (int i = 0; i < ARRAYSIZE(gRegCLSIDs); i++) {
if (IsEqualGUID(rclsid, gRegCLSIDs[i])) {
found = true;
break;
}
}
if (!found)
return E_FAIL;
if (!IsEqualGUID(riid, IID_IUnknown) && !IsEqualGUID(riid, IID_IClassFactory))
return E_NOINTERFACE;
WebKitClassFactory* factory = new WebKitClassFactory(rclsid);
*ppv = reinterpret_cast<LPVOID>(factory);
if (!factory)
return E_OUTOFMEMORY;
factory->AddRef();
return S_OK;
}
STDAPI DllCanUnloadNow(void)
{
if (!gClassCount && !gLockCount)
return S_OK;
return S_FALSE;
}

static void substituteGUID(LPTSTR str, const UUID* guid)
{
if (!guid || !str)
return;
TCHAR uuidString[40];
_stprintf_s(uuidString, ARRAYSIZE(uuidString), TEXT("%08X-%04X-%04X-%02X%02X-%02X%02X%02X%02X%02X%02X"), guid->Data1, guid->Data2, guid->Data3,
guid->Data4[0], guid->Data4[1], guid->Data4[2], guid->Data4[3], guid->Data4[4], guid->Data4[5], guid->Data4[6], guid->Data4[7]);
LPCTSTR guidPattern = TEXT("########-####-####-####-############");
size_t patternLength = _tcslen(guidPattern);
size_t strLength = _tcslen(str);
LPTSTR guidSubStr = str;
while (strLength) {
guidSubStr = _tcsstr(guidSubStr, guidPattern);
if (!guidSubStr)
break;
_tcsncpy(guidSubStr, uuidString, patternLength);
guidSubStr += patternLength;
strLength -= (guidSubStr - str);
}
}
STDAPI DllUnregisterServer(void)
{
HRESULT hr = S_OK;
HKEY userClasses;
#if __PRODUCTION__
const GUID libID = LIBID_WebKit;
#else
const GUID libID = LIBID_OpenSourceWebKit;
#endif
typedef HRESULT (WINAPI *UnRegisterTypeLibForUserPtr)(REFGUID, unsigned short, unsigned short, LCID, SYSKIND);
if (UnRegisterTypeLibForUserPtr unRegisterTypeLibForUser = reinterpret_cast<UnRegisterTypeLibForUserPtr>(GetProcAddress(GetModuleHandle(TEXT("oleaut32.dll")), "UnRegisterTypeLibForUser")))
unRegisterTypeLibForUser(libID, __BUILD_NUMBER_MAJOR__, __BUILD_NUMBER_MINOR__, 0, SYS_WIN32);
else
UnRegisterTypeLib(libID, __BUILD_NUMBER_MAJOR__, __BUILD_NUMBER_MINOR__, 0, SYS_WIN32);
if (RegOpenKeyEx(HKEY_CURRENT_USER, TEXT("SOFTWARE\\CLASSES"), 0, KEY_WRITE, &userClasses) != ERROR_SUCCESS)
userClasses = 0;
int nEntries = ARRAYSIZE(gRegTable);
for (int i = nEntries - 1; i >= 0; i--) {
LPTSTR pszKeyName = _tcsdup(gRegTable[i][0]);
if (pszKeyName) {
substituteGUID(pszKeyName, &gRegCLSIDs[i/gSlotsPerEntry]);
RegDeleteKey(HKEY_CLASSES_ROOT, pszKeyName);
if (userClasses)
RegDeleteKey(userClasses, pszKeyName);
free(pszKeyName);
} else
hr = E_OUTOFMEMORY;
}
if (userClasses)
RegCloseKey(userClasses);
return hr;
}
STDAPI DllRegisterServer(void)
{
HRESULT hr = S_OK;
// look up server's file name
TCHAR szFileName[MAX_PATH];
GetModuleFileName(gInstance, szFileName, MAX_PATH);
typedef HRESULT (WINAPI *RegisterTypeLibForUserPtr)(ITypeLib*, OLECHAR*, OLECHAR*);
COMPtr<ITypeLib> typeLib;
LoadTypeLibEx(szFileName, REGKIND_NONE, &typeLib);
if (RegisterTypeLibForUserPtr registerTypeLibForUser = reinterpret_cast<RegisterTypeLibForUserPtr>(GetProcAddress(GetModuleHandle(TEXT("oleaut32.dll")), "RegisterTypeLibForUser")))
registerTypeLibForUser(typeLib.get(), szFileName, 0);
else
RegisterTypeLib(typeLib.get(), szFileName, 0);
HKEY userClasses;
if (RegOpenKeyEx(HKEY_CURRENT_USER, TEXT("SOFTWARE\\CLASSES"), 0, KEY_WRITE, &userClasses) != ERROR_SUCCESS)
userClasses = 0;
// register entries from table
int nEntries = ARRAYSIZE(gRegTable);
for (int i = 0; SUCCEEDED(hr) && i < nEntries; i++) {
LPTSTR pszKeyName = _tcsdup(gRegTable[i][0]);
LPTSTR pszValueName = gRegTable[i][1] ? _tcsdup(gRegTable[i][1]) : 0;
LPTSTR allocatedValue = (gRegTable[i][2] != (LPTSTR)-1) ? _tcsdup(gRegTable[i][2]) : (LPTSTR)-1;
LPTSTR pszValue = allocatedValue;
if (pszKeyName && pszValue) {
int clsidIndex = i/gSlotsPerEntry;
substituteGUID(pszKeyName, &gRegCLSIDs[clsidIndex]);
substituteGUID(pszValueName, &gRegCLSIDs[clsidIndex]);
// map rogue value to module file name
if (pszValue == (LPTSTR)-1)
pszValue = szFileName;
else
substituteGUID(pszValue, &gRegCLSIDs[clsidIndex]);
// create the key
HKEY hkey;
LONG err = RegCreateKey(HKEY_CLASSES_ROOT, pszKeyName, &hkey);
if (err != ERROR_SUCCESS && userClasses)
err = RegCreateKey(userClasses, pszKeyName, &hkey);
if (err == ERROR_SUCCESS) {
// set the value
err = RegSetValueEx(hkey, pszValueName, 0, REG_SZ, (const BYTE*)pszValue, (DWORD) sizeof(pszValue[0])*(_tcslen(pszValue) + 1));
RegCloseKey(hkey);
}
}
if (pszKeyName)
free(pszKeyName);
if (pszValueName)
free(pszValueName);
if (allocatedValue && allocatedValue != (LPTSTR)-1)
free(allocatedValue);
}
if (userClasses)
RegCloseKey(userClasses);
return hr;
}
